Systasea is a genus of skippers in the family Hesperiidae.
The name Systasea was introduced as a replacement for the name Lintneria, which is invalid under the Law of Homonymy.
Species
- Systasea microsticta Dyar, 1923
- Systasea pulverulenta (R. Felder, 1869)
- Systasea zampa (Edwards, 1876)
Identify
- Outer margin of hindwing has 2 deep indentations.
- Upperside is orange-brown with darker olive-brown areas.
- Forewing has a median band of transparent spots all in a row.
- Wing Span: 15/16 - 1 3/8 inches (2.4 - 3.5 cm).
